The Gluttonous Run is part of the 7 Deadly Sins race series and takes place on Friday 15th January 2027 at Pengethley Manor, Ross-on-Wye (what3words: physical.growth.shelf). Entrants have a seven hour limit to complete their chosen target distance. Each lap is 2.5 km and the course is offroad within the manor grounds, including a hill and a series of ups and downs through two vineyards. The organiser describes the course as very tough. The event is open to walkers and runners; entrants must meet the organiser's entry requirements and agree to the event terms and conditions.

Distances offered include:

  • 5k (2 laps of 2.5 km)
  • 10k
  • Half Marathon
  • Full Marathon
  • Ultra

Options include an in-person race day and a virtual entry. Virtual runs may be completed any day in January with a minimum distance of 5k; virtual entrants receive a personalised virtual bib and, after verification of the run, a medal posted to them (additional postage applies for overseas). Race medals and virtual medals are the same type; paid in-person finishers receive medals at the finish.

Practical notes: free parking, free tea & coffee, sandwiches & soup, and toilets are available on site. Entry fees are non-refundable. Entry prices stated by the organiser are Race Entry £29.00, Virtual UK £25.00, Virtual Overseas £39.00. A charity entry option is available at a discounted fee with a fundraising commitment.
